# 1. Step: Install Flatpak on your system: https://flatpak.org/setup/ (More information about FLatpak: https://youtu.be/SavmR9ZtHg0)
 | 
						|
# 2. Step: Open a Terminal and run this command: cd Downloads && chmod +x fusion360-flatpak-install.sh && bash fusion360-flatpak-install.sh
 | 
						|
# 3. Step: The installation will now start and set up everything for you automatically.
 | 
						|
# 4. Step: Now you can use my other file "fusion360-flatpak-start.sh" for running Autodesk Fusion 360 on your system.
 | 
						|
############################################################################################################################################################
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
############################################################################################################################################################
 | 
						|
# The next two steps are also very important for you, because on some Linux Distrubition you dosn't get to work Flatpak without these steps!!!
 | 
						|
############################################################################################################################################################
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
# 1. Step: Open a Terminal and run this command sudo nano /etc/hosts (Change this file wihtout # !)
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#     127.0.0.1     localhost
 | 
						|
#     127.0.1.1     EXAMPLE-NAME
 | 
						|
     
 | 
						|
#     ::1 ip6-localhost ip6-loopback
 | 
						|
#     fe00::0 ip6-localnet
 | 
						|
#     ff00::0 ip6-mcastprefix
 | 
						|
#     ff02::1 ip6-allnodes
 | 
						|
#     ff02::2 ip6-allrouters
 | 
						|
#     ff02::3 ip6-allhosts
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
# 2. Step: Run this command: sudo nano /etc/hostname (Change this file wihtout # !)
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#    EXAMPLE-NAME
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
# 3. Step: Reboot your system!

# Decide which package manager is in use, and install the packages
 | 
						|
function install-requirement {
 | 
						|
if VERB="$( which apt-get )" 2> /dev/null; then
 | 
						|
   echo "Debian-based"
 | 
						|
   sudo apt-get update &&
 | 
						|
   sudo apt-get install dialog wmctrl software-properties-common
 | 
						|
elif VERB="$( which dnf )" 2> /dev/null; then
 | 
						|
   echo "RedHat-based"
 | 
						|
   sudo dnf update &&
 | 
						|
   sudo dnf install dialog wmctrl
 | 
						|
elif VERB="$( which pacman )" 2> /dev/null; then
 | 
						|
   echo "Arch-based"
 | 
						|
   sudo pacman -Sy --needed dialog wmctrl
 | 
						|
elif VERB="$( which zypper )" 2> /dev/null; then
 | 
						|
   echo "openSUSE-based"
 | 
						|
   su -c 'zypper up && zypper install dialog wmctrl'
 | 
						|
elif VERB="$( which xbps-install )" 2> /dev/null; then
 | 
						|
   echo "Void-based"
 | 
						|
   sudo xbps-install -Sy dialog wmctrl
 | 
						|
elif VERB="$( which eopkg )" 2> /dev/null; then
 | 
						|
   echo "Solus-based"
 | 
						|
   sudo eopkg install dialog wmctrl
 | 
						|
elif VERB="$( which emerge )" 2> /dev/null; then
 | 
						|
    echo "Gentoo-based"
 | 
						|
    sudo emerge -av dev-util/dialog x11-misc/wmctrl
 | 
						|
else
 | 
						|
   echo "I can't find your package manager!"
 | 
						|
   exit;
 | 
						|
fi
 | 
						|
}
